Transaction 8683849193f19d5100e11ef25dea3f57708cb5de34bb24ced658ab51081f8321

1 Input
2 Outputs
  • 8683849193f19d5100e11ef25dea3f57708cb5de34bb24ced658ab51081f8321:0
  • value  1974785
    address  35JXX76he6bRwKn5GWZUBkDRfrEPqJ57eU
  • 8683849193f19d5100e11ef25dea3f57708cb5de34bb24ced658ab51081f8321:1
  • value  48907
    address  17dwS9qp2ATBueChhBRAc4oHyTkT9N8iri